Subject: [PATCH 152/173] ext4: fix credits computing for indirect mapped files

2.6.27.59-stable review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let us know.

------------------

From: Yongqiang Yang <xiaoqiangnk@...il.com>

commit 5b41395fcc0265fc9f193aef9df39ce49d64677c upstream.

When writing a contiguous set of blocks, two indirect blocks could be
needed depending on how the blocks are aligned, so we need to increase
the number of credits needed by one.

[ Also fixed a another bug which could further underestimate the
  number of journal credits needed by 1; the code was using integer
  division instead of DIV_ROUND_UP() -- tytso]

 fs/ext4/inode.c |   11 +++++------
 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

--- a/fs/ext4/inode.c
+++ b/fs/ext4/inode.c
@@ -5458,13 +5458,12 @@ static int ext4_indirect_trans_blocks(st
 	/* if nrblocks are contiguous */
 	if (chunk) {
 		/*
-		 * With N contiguous data blocks, it need at most
-		 * N/EXT4_ADDR_PER_BLOCK(inode->i_sb) indirect blocks
-		 * 2 dindirect blocks
-		 * 1 tindirect block
+		 * With N contiguous data blocks, we need at most
+		 * N/EXT4_ADDR_PER_BLOCK(inode->i_sb) + 1 indirect blocks,
+		 * 2 dindirect blocks, and 1 tindirect block
 		 */
-		indirects = nrblocks / EXT4_ADDR_PER_BLOCK(inode->i_sb);
-		return indirects + 3;
+		return DIV_ROUND_UP(nrblocks,
+				    EXT4_ADDR_PER_BLOCK(inode->i_sb)) + 4;
 	}
